Output 582052e43bad15618f0f9487230427cecb83a2bce99204c8a7d2e2f2ee482558:0

value
275756
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 23fcb44dfb7de157dc1070edfc95c77e75655f88 OP_EQUALVERIFY OP_CHECKSIG
address
14HHNvE5bSoCA4zgWmVNkfkzfiqSDjN6qa
transaction
582052e43bad15618f0f9487230427cecb83a2bce99204c8a7d2e2f2ee482558
spent
true